Mass spectrometry measures the molecular weight of a compound with severe precision. For peptides, one of the most common strategies are electrospray ionization (ESI-MS) and matrix-assisted laser desorption/ionization time-of-flight (MALDI-TOF). HPLC separates a combination right into its private elements based on just how each molecule interacts with a specially created column. The liquified peptide example is infused right into a stream of liquid solvent (the mobile phase) that streams through a tube packed with tiny bits (the stationary phase). Different molecules "stick" to those particles with various strengths, so Biochemistry they travel through the column at various rates. What device is made use of to check peptide pureness? Peptide pureness is consistently figured out by HPLC (high efficiency liquid chromatography). This method allows separation and loved one quantification of each peptide manufactured. If paired to a mass spectrometer (MS), this gives molecular mass/ identity details of the target peptide and going along with contaminations. Chromatogram Or No Chromatogram? Recognizing what the information suggests overviews your choices regarding the checked product. Endotoxins are lipopolysaccharides from gram-negative germs. Even trace quantities can trigger pyrogenic (fever-inducing) actions in human beings. Endotoxins Pharmaceutical Manufacturing are very heat-stable, so typical sanitation can not ruin them. They additionally adhere well to lab devices, permitting contamination to spread out quickly. Antiviral peptides focused on protecting against S-protein-mediated fusion, viral launch, and the restraint of the significant protease have been established as therapeutical methods for coronavirus infection therapy. Among these, EK1 (Number 10), a 34-amino acid fusion repressive peptide, should have to be mentioned. This peptide targets the HR1 domain names of the spike (S) glycoproteins in numerous viruses, consisting of SARS-CoV-1, MERS-CoV, and 3 SARS-related SoVs, thus preventing infection combination. A lipid alteration was included in EK1 by adding cholesterol or palmitic acid to the peptide via a brief spacer. Mass spectrometry gives conclusive verification of peptide identification by determining the specific molecular weight of the substance, typically to within 0.01% of the academic value. Liquid Chromatography Solutions For research peptides, molecular weight verification confirms the designated series, identifies alterations such as oxidation or deamidation, and verifies the absence of pollutants that might co-elute during HPLC analysis. Modern tools can perform tandem MS, fragmenting the peptide to verify the actual amino acid series. TB4 can upregulate VEGF by means of HIF-1α stabilization and engage pathways linked to cell survival and matrix remodeling; TB-500, as the energetic concept, is supposed to leverage overlapping routes. The LKKTET(Q) motif binds G-actin, buffering monomers and regulating polymerization so cells can rapidly restructure their cytoskeleton and relocate into damaged cells. TB-500 is a brand/formulation name for a brief TB4-derived peptide-- especially the N-acetylated 17-- 23 fragment (LKKTETQ) of thymosin β4 (the actin-binding motif). Background Of Peptide-based Therapeutics In Diabetic IssuesIn addition, through PEG and cholesterol modification, the P315V3 lipopeptide with about 1000-fold greater task was acquired (HY3000).468 It can bind to the HR1 area of the S protein of SARS-CoV-2 and prevent membrane layer combination to avoid the virus from getting in the cell interior. At the exact same time, https://privatebin.net/?9e9732d3f1ba3628#2kemc9E7Crtigv8HT3a7bwsceNVAW5GyP6RKCRY68Wiv the hydrophobic tail of HY3000 can be taken care of to the surface area of the cell membrane, developing a safety obstacle at the cell surface area. Furthermore, it can prevent SARS-CoV, MERS-CoV and seasonal COVs HCoV-NL63, HCoV-229E and HCoV-OC43, HY3100 reveals a wide range of COVs. Based on the reliable antiviral effect, HY3000 nasal spray was accepted by NMPA for phase I medical test in August 2022. In order to accomplish dental delivery of peptide medicines, researchers need to overcome various biochemical and physical obstacles in the gastrointestinal tract (Fig. 13). To start with, peptide medications come across digestion by enzymes in the oral cavity, belly and intestinal tracts, which break down the peptides right into smaller sized molecules, causing loss or decrease of their task, calling for regular management. COVs are covered infections with a positive-stranded, single-stranded RNA genome of 26 to 32 kb in size. Throughout SARS-CoV-2 infection of the host, the S protein on the external surface of the viral bits is accountable for binding to the host receptor for accessory to the cell membrane layer, adhered to by combination of the viral and host cell membranes and release of the viral genomic RNA right into the cell. Next, there is blend of the virus and host cell membrane layers and launch of viral genomic RNA right into the cell. Consequently, two viral replicase polyproteins are equated into two polyproteins, pp1a and pp1ab, by regulating the manufacturing of two viral replicase polyproteins by host ribosomes.452 These can be further processed by viral-encoded proteases in 16 mature nonstructural healthy proteins (NSPs). Sermorelin works as a development hormone-releasing hormone (GHRH) analog, motivating the pituitary to produce and secrete GH. Ipamorelin is a growth hormone secretagogue that simulates ghrelin, binding to receptors that motivate GH launch without considerably affecting hunger or cortisol levels.
